Hospital gang scandal: Caused the deaths of 12 babies!

A complaint from a new mother has brought to light a healthcare scandal that has shaken Turkey. A hospital gang that infiltrated neonatal units was reportedly filling the intensive care units of contracted hospitals in exchange for 8,000 TL per day.

THEY CAUSED THE DEATHS OF BABIES

It is alleged that the gang, which included doctors and nurses, caused the deaths of 12 babies. Journalist Emrullah Erdinç announced this horrific situation with video and audio recordings he shared on his YouTube channel.

 

THE SCANDAL BEGAN WITH A MOTHER'S STATEMENT

The scandal, featured in a video published on journalist Emrullah Erdinç's YouTube channel, emerged following a complaint from a mother who stated that her baby had not been shown to her for 14 days and that she was not even allowed to breastfeed. The mother questioned why her baby, who was healthy before birth, had been admitted to intensive care.

ILLICIT PROFIT AND THE GANG'S METHODS

It was determined that the gang issued invoices of 8,000 TL per day, admitting babies to intensive care who did not need to be hospitalized, thereby generating over 1 billion in illicit profit.

Contracted Hospitals and Arrests

The gang was filling intensive care units by making agreements with specific hospitals. It was recently reported that some 112 emergency service personnel associated with this gang have also been arrested.

A YOUNG NURSE'S DESPERATION

A 23-year-old nurse stated that there were 9 babies in intensive care and their families were waiting, asking, "What will I do if something happens to one of these babies?"

HORRIFYING INSTRUCTIONS

While one of the gang members said, "If something happens, call the doctor," the response of another was terrifying: "If they expire, pull the plug."

ALLEGATIONS SPREAD

Allegations that the scandal mostly took place in Istanbul, and that similar incidents occurred in Çorlu and Tekirdağ, are being investigated. Erdinç stated that he shared the video and audio recordings uncensored and that the events are much deeper.
